Jeanette Berger is a French artist renowned for her versatile voice and timeless soul music. A pianist, songwriter and performer, she draws inspiration from artists such as Ray Charles and Alicia Keys. Her second studio album, "Do Your Thing", released in October 2024, illustrates her ability to fuse different musical genres, including pop and gospel.
Jyha, who came to light at the Tremplin Émergences in 2024, will be supporting Jeanette Berger in her concert. She sings in a neo-soul and American pop vein, drawing inspiration from the likes of Billie Eilish and Jorja Smith. Her unique voice and authenticity have led her to perform at the 24 Heures de Beaune and as support act for Ayo at the Sons d'une Nuit d'Été festival in Nuits-Saint-Georges. She took advantage of these opportunities to compose new songs, which culminated - in September 2025 - in the release of her first EP.
